Connecting Joy-Con to Nintendo Switch
To get started with playing Fortnite using Joy-Con controllers, players need to ensure they are connected properly to their Nintendo Switch console. The connection process is relatively straightforward:
- Attach the Joy-Con to the Nintendo Switch console or use them wirelessly. If you opt to play in handheld mode, simply slide the Joy-Con onto the console itself. For tabletop mode or TV mode, hold down the small circular sync button found on the side of the Joy-Con until the lights begin to flash.
- Navigate to the Home Menu – Once connected, head to the home screen where Fortnite resides.
- Launch Fortnite – Open the game, and the Joy-Con should be recognized and ready for use.
Keep in mind that Joy-Con may need to be re-synced if the console has recently been put to rest or if there’s interference from other wireless devices. Regular maintenance of the Joy-Con’s batteries is also essential to prevent unplanned disconnects during crucial gameplay moments.
Specific Settings for Optimal Performance
Once the Joy-Con are successfully connected, fine-tuning their settings can lead to a more optimal gameplay experience in Fortnite. Here are several considerations to enhance performance:
- Adjust Sensitivity Settings: Within Fortnite’s settings menu, tweaking the sensitivity of the joystick can cater to individual play styles. A higher sensitivity might benefit those who prefer quick reflexes, while others might want a lower sensitivity for more precision during combat.
- Custom Control Layout: Fortnite allows players to customize their control mappings. This flexibility is crucial for players who use Joy-Con, as it enables them to set their preferred layout that matches their comfort and gameplay style.
- Calibration: Occasionally, recalibrating the Joy-Con helps in correcting any drifting or inaccurate movements that may occur. This is done through the controller settings menu on the Nintendo Switch.
Tip: Experiment with different settings to find what works best for you. Every gamer has a unique play style that can be enhanced with the right configurations.

Input Lag and Sensitivity Issues
One of the primary concerns players encounter with Joy-Con controllers is input lag. Input lag is essentially the delay between a player's action and the corresponding response in the game. Joy-Cons, while innovative, may not always keep up with the rapid demands of fast-paced gameplay.
There are several factors that contribute to this issue:
- Wireless Connectivity: Joy-Cons operate on Bluetooth technology. This can create a slight delay, especially if there's interference from other devices, like Wi-Fi routers or microwaves.
- Environmental Factors: Using Joy-Cons in a crowded room with several wireless devices could lead to additional latency, affecting performance. The closer you are to the Switch, the better!
- Game Settings: Fortnite has various settings, such as sensitivity adjustments, that can either exacerbate or alleviate the impacts of input lag. Finding the sweet spot is important.
For experienced gamers in Fortnite, where milliseconds can mean the difference between victory and defeat, even minor input delays can be detrimental. Therefore, staying vigilant to these potential pitfalls is key to maintaining competitive edge.

Durability and Wear Over Time
While having a pair of Joy-Cons can be great, players should also be mindful of their durability. As with any piece of tech, wear and tear is inevitable over time. Although they are designed to be robust, certain aspects can impact their longevity, including:
- Frequent Usage: The more you play Fortnite, the more stress you place on these controllers. The thumbsticks may get loose or the buttons may become less responsive with heavy use.
- Battery Degradation: The battery life of Joy-Cons depletes over time. As the battery ages, players may notice shorter play sessions or lag in responsiveness, making reliability a concern in crucial moments.
- Cleaning and Maintenance: Dust and grime can accumulate in the joints and prods of the Joy-Con, hindering performance. Neglecting basic cleaning can lead to issues on-the-go during a match.
Ultimately, while Joy-Con controllers offer unique advantages, their susceptibility to wear can pose challenges during intense gaming sessions. Thus, keen attention to both performance and upkeep of the controllers can help mitigate these issues over time.
